Attenborough out of hospital

Veteran actor Richard Attenborough is recovering at home after spending more than a month in hospital.

The 85-year-old Oscar winner fell and suffered a knock to the head on December 18 last year.

He slipped into a coma and was admitted to St George's Hospital in Tooting, West London.

The actor/director subsequently regained consciousness but was kept under observation by doctors over Christmas and for most of January.

A spokesman for the star announced he has now been deemed well enough to go home, but will have to skip all of his work engagements until his health improves.

The representative told British newspaper the Daily Express: "He is out of hospital and on the mend but it is a slow process. It was a nasty tumble and he is not as young as he used to be."
